But the biggest music story of the year is the birth of —a fusion of hip-hop and dangdut that is taking the internet by storm. This energetic blend combines the rapid beats of the kendang koplo with modern electronic rhythms and rap flows. Tracks like "Garam & Madu (Sakit Dadaku)" by Tenxi, Naykilla, and Jemsii have become inescapable audio trends, proving that Indonesia's youth are eager to remix their cultural heritage for a contemporary audience. As one observer noted, "the thud of the dangdut drum is now increasingly heard alongside modern hip-hop beats," creating a sound that is both familiar and thrillingly new.

Indonesian YouTube is a diverse ecosystem of gamers, vloggers, and musicians. At the very top is , the gaming and lifestyle creator who retains the crown as the YouTuber with the most subscribers , boasting a staggering 54.5 million followers . But the battle for monthly views is fierce. The family-friendly channel Keizo & Friends dominated in May 2026, pulling in an astonishing 447.49 million views in 30 days .
